When your opponents goes to initiate movement you've got two choices – either try to STOP the movement or GO WITH the movement. Both approaches are very effective – which one you choose in a given case will depend on the circumstances of that case – which one you choose in general will be determined by your body type and personality. One is not better than the other, but they do amount to very different expressions of Jiu jitsu. garry tonon was a master of FOLLOWING an opponents movement – gordon ryan was a master of stopping an opponents movement.
